您当前位置: 首页 >  帮助中心 >  谷歌浏览器如何减少渲染过程中的资源冲突

谷歌浏览器如何减少渲染过程中的资源冲突

文章来源:谷歌浏览器官网 时间:2025-05-05

谷歌浏览器如何减少渲染过程中的资源冲突1

在浏览网页时,谷歌浏览器的渲染过程可能会因资源冲突而导致页面加载缓慢或显示异常。了解如何减少这些资源冲突,能显著提升浏览体验。
一、优化缓存机制
1. 合理设置缓存头:通过设置合适的缓存头信息,如Expires或Cache-Control,让浏览器能够长时间缓存资源。这样,在再次访问相同页面时,可以直接从缓存中获取资源,减少网络请求和渲染时间。例如,对于不经常变动的静态资源,可以设置较长的缓存时间。
2. 利用协商缓存:采用ETag或Last-Modified等技术实现资源的验证和更新。当浏览器再次请求资源时,服务器可以通过验证这些标识来判断资源是否已被修改。如果资源未被修改,服务器可以返回304 Not Modified状态码,浏览器则直接使用本地缓存的资源,避免不必要的重新下载和渲染。
二、优化脚本加载
1. 使用defer和async属性:对于不重要的JavaScript脚本,可以使用`defer`属性延迟执行,直到HTML文档解析完成。这可以避免脚本阻塞页面的渲染过程,提高页面的初始加载速度。而对于独立的脚本文件,使用`async`属性使其异步加载,同样不会阻塞页面渲染。多个脚本文件可以并行加载,加快整体加载速度。
2. 精简脚本代码:检查并优化JavaScript脚本代码,去除不必要的复杂逻辑和冗余代码。压缩脚本文件,去除注释和多余的空格,减小文件大小,从而减少浏览器解析和执行脚本的时间。同时,合理组织脚本的加载顺序,确保关键脚本优先加载和执行。
三、优化样式加载
1. 将CSS样式表放在头部:在HTML文档的头部引入CSS样式表,可以让浏览器在渲染页面之前先加载样式信息。这样,页面元素在渲染时可以直接应用样式,避免了因样式未加载而导致的页面重绘和回流,提高渲染效率。
2. 合并和压缩CSS文件:将多个小的CSS文件合并为一个大的文件,并对其进行压缩处理。减少CSS文件的数量可以降低浏览器的请求次数,而压缩后的CSS文件体积更小,加载速度更快。同时,合理组织CSS选择器和样式规则,避免过于复杂的嵌套和重复定义。
四、优化图片资源
1. 选择合适的图片格式:根据图片的内容和用途,选择合适的图片格式。例如,对于照片等色彩丰富的图片,可以使用JPEG格式;对于图标和简单的图形,可以使用PNG格式;对于需要透明背景且颜色简单的图片,可以使用SVG格式。此外,WebP是一种新兴的图片格式,它能够在保证图片质量的同时,大大减小文件大小,提高图片加载速度。
2. 对图片进行压缩:使用专业的图片压缩工具,如TinyPNG等,对图片进行压缩处理。在不影响图片视觉效果的前提下,尽量减小图片的文件大小。同时,根据页面的布局和设备屏幕的分辨率,合理调整图片的尺寸和分辨率,避免加载过大的图片。

综上所述,通过优化缓存机制、脚本加载、样式加载以及图片资源等方面,可以有效减少谷歌浏览器在渲染过程中的资源冲突,提升页面加载速度和浏览体验。用户可以根据自己的需求和实际情况,灵活运用这些方法来优化网页性能。
如何通过谷歌浏览器加速音频资源的加载进度

上一篇>如何通过谷歌浏览器加速音频资源的加载进度

已经是最新一篇啦~

下一篇>已经是最新一篇啦~

继续阅读
Chrome版本碎片化危机:运维人员的噩梦现状 04-21 如何在Chrome浏览器中提升浏览体验 04-15 安卓Chrome如何查看和删除浏览历史 03-15 Chrome浏览器量子分形加密保护数字艺术版权 05-03 谷歌浏览器对高资源占用标签页的管理方法 04-26 谷歌浏览器安全性分析与隐私保护建议 05-03 Google浏览器如何解决网页显示错误 05-05 在Chrome浏览器中管理缓存和清理历史记录 05-05 Google Chrome的网页阅读模式如何开启和优化 03-24 谷歌浏览器如何优化视频流媒体的播放体验 04-12
返回顶部